Other important factors to consider when purchasing a cottage in Ballinafad is whether the land lease has been
paid and ownership has been transferred from government to the cottage owner; whether or not the cottage is road accessible year-round, and
if the cottage is located on a waterfront. All of these factors may increase the value of your investment.
